What You’ll Do
- Lead with reliability – Oversee and execute maintenance operations across all areas of the hotel, ensuring everything runs efficiently, safely, and beautifully.
- Protect our promise – Conduct regular inspections of guest rooms, public spaces, and back-of-house areas to maintain top-quality standards.
- Think ahead – Champion preventive maintenance and energy management programs to reduce downtime and improve efficiency.
- Problem-solve with purpose – Troubleshoot and repair systems including HVAC, electrical, and plumbing — keeping comfort and safety at the forefront.
- Collaborate across teams – Partner with department heads to ensure smooth operations and quick responses to any maintenance needs.
- Lead by example – Train, guide, and inspire engineering team members to uphold excellence and accountability.
- Represent quality – Manage projects, renovations, and FF&E replacements to keep the property fresh, functional, and inviting.
- Ensure safety always – Follow all regulations, report hazards immediately, and maintain a culture of responsibility.
- Support operations – Work closely with the General Manager and leadership team to create a seamless, world-class guest experience.
What You Bring
- 3–5 years of maintenance leadership experience in hospitality or a service-driven environment
- Strong technical skills across HVAC, electrical, plumbing, carpentry, and mechanical systems
- Hotel or property management experience preferred
- HVAC certification or equivalent technical training is a plus
- Familiarity with building, fire, and safety codes
- A proactive mindset — you don’t wait for problems, you prevent them
- Strong attention to detail, time management, and communication skills
- Ability to multitask and maintain high standards in a fast-paced environment
- Flexibility to work evenings, weekends, and holidays as needed
- Ability to lift up to 25 pounds and perform hands-on maintenance tasks
